About This Audiobook
Experience the dynamic journey of entrepreneurship through 'Think and Grow Rich: The Legacy' by James Whittaker, narrated by Rich Germaine. This audiobook offers a unique blend of real-life success stories, from overcoming adversity to achieving unparalleled success. Each episode delves into the mindset and strategies that propelled today's leading figures to greatness, making it an essential listen for anyone aspiring to transform their career or life. The narrative is engaging and motivational, with Germaine’s clear and articulate delivery enhancing the storytelling experience.
